Why Short Term Health Insurance?

Short term health insurance is designed to provide temporary coverage for individuals who need insurance for a short period of time. This type of insurance is ideal for people who are in between jobs, waiting for their employer's insurance to start, or students who are no longer covered under their parent's insurance. Short term health insurance can also be an option for those who missed the open enrollment period for ACA-compliant plans.

Benefits of Short Term Health Insurance

One of the main benefits of short term health insurance is that it is usually less expensive than traditional health insurance plans. Short term plans typically have lower monthly premiums and may offer more flexibility in terms of coverage options. Additionally, short term plans can be purchased at any time, not just during open enrollment.

Who is eligible for Short Term Health Insurance?

Short term health insurance is available to anyone who needs temporary coverage. However, there are some restrictions to keep in mind. Short term plans do not meet the minimum essential coverage requirements of the Affordable Care Act (ACA), which means they do not cover pre-existing conditions. Additionally, short term plans may have limited coverage options and may not cover certain medical expenses.

What is Covered in Short Term Health Insurance?

Short term health insurance typically covers basic medical expenses such as doctor visits, emergency room visits, and hospital stays. Some plans may also cover prescription drugs and laboratory tests. However, it is important to read the policy carefully to understand what is and is not covered.

What is short term health insurance?

Short term health insurance is a type of temporary health insurance that provides coverage for a limited period of time, typically between one to twelve months. It is ideal for individuals who need temporary coverage due to a life transition or unexpected circumstance.

Who is eligible for short term health insurance?

Short term health insurance is available to individuals who are in good health and do not have any pre-existing medical conditions. It is also available to those who are between jobs, waiting for employer-sponsored coverage to begin, or in need of temporary coverage for any reason.

What does short term health insurance cover?

Short term health insurance typically covers basic medical services such as doctor visits, emergency care, hospitalization, and prescription drugs. However, it may not cover pre-existing conditions, preventive care, or mental health services.
